In 2025, Planetarium Labs announced the completion of a $3 million funding round, primarily supported by Spartan Group, Immutable, MARBLEX, Comma3 Ventures, and several well-known angel investors. Previously, the team had raised $32 million in Series A funding, continuously solidifying its position in the Web3 gaming sector.
Developed by Busy Beans Studio, Immortal Rising 2 has quickly attracted over 8.8 million downloads globally since its launch, becoming one of the most active games in the Immutable ecosystem. Immutable co-founder Robbie Ferguson emphasized that the game combines the advantages of Asia’s largest gaming market, mobile platform design, and deep Web3 integration, perfectly aligning player interests with game growth.
The upcoming Token Generation Event (TGE) will introduce a decentralized mechanism for governance shared by players and investors. This move not only strengthens players’ sense of involvement but also opens an important gateway for Immortal Rising 2 to enter the Web3 ecosystem, promoting a dual upgrade of gaming experience and economic benefits.
Immortal Rising 2, designed by a BAFTA winner, is positioned as a next-generation idle RPG that merges the rhythm of traditional mobile games with blockchain innovation. The platform plans to combine Immutable zkEVM scaling technology with the Immutable Play platform to achieve a seamless transition from Web2 to Web3, attracting more traditional users into the world of blockchain gaming.
